Aimee Mann and Squeeze at Ravinia - Celebrated singer-songwriter and former 'Til Tuesday leader Mann recently released her latest offering, "@#%&*! Smilers," to consistently positive reviews. She'll join classic new wave pop band Squeeze at Ravinia Sunday night. It should be a great show, as both have a knack for combining pop hooks with thoughtfulness and wit. More info and tickets.
